oracle建表空间各种语句.docxVIP

  • 4
  • 0
  • 约5.65千字
  • 约 5页
  • 2021-06-24 发布于广东
  • 举报
标准化工作室编码[XX968T-XX89628-XJ668-XT689N] 标准化工作室编码[XX968T-XX89628-XJ668-XT689N] Oracle建表空间各种语句 在创建用户之前,先要创建表空间: ??????其格式为:格式:createtablespace表间名datafile数据文件名size表空间大小; ???????如: ???????SQLcreatetablespacenews_tablespacedatafileF:\oradata\news\news_data.dbfsize500M; ??????其中news_tablespace是你自定义的表空间oradata\news\news_data.dbf是数据文件的存放位置,news_data.dbf文件名也是任意取;size500M是指定该数据文件的大小,也就是表空间的大小。 ??????现在建好了名为news_tablespace的表空间,下面就可以创建用户了: ??????其格式为:格式:createuser用户名identifiedby密码defaulttablespace表空间表; ????????如: ??????SQLcreateusernewsidentifiedbynewsdefaulttablespacenews_tablespace; ???????默认表空间defaulttablespace使用上面创建的表空间。 ??????接着授权给新建的用户: ???SQLgrantconnect,resourcetonews;--表示把connect,resource权限授予news用户 ???SQLgrantdbatonews;--表示把dba权限授予给news用户 ???授权成功。 ok!数据库用户创建完成,现在你就可以使用该用户创建数据表了! 1.建表空间 createtablespacehoteldatadatafile200mautoextendonnext10mmaxsizeunlimited; 2.建用户 createuserhotelidentifiedbyhoteldefaulttablespacehoteldataaccountunlock;//identifiedby后面的是密码,前面的是用户名 3.用户授权 grantresource,connect,RECOVERY_CATALOG_OWNERtohotel; grantcreatetabletohotel; alteruserhotelquotaunlimitedONOSDB; alteruserhoteldefaulttablespacehoteldata; 4.删除表空间 DROPTABLESPACEhoteldataINCLUDINGCONTENTSANDDATAFILES; 5.删除用户 DROPUSERhotelCASCADE 6.删除表的注意事项 在删除一个表中的全部数据时,须使用TRUNCATETABLE表名;因为用DROPTABLE,DELETE*FROM表名时,TABLESPACE表空间该表的占用空间并未释放,反复几次DROP,DELETE操作后,该TABLESPACE上百兆的空间就被耗光了。 oraclesqlplus脚本建库总结(原创) ******************************************************************/ --查询表空间参数 selecttablespace_name,min_extents,max_extents,pct_increase,statusfromdba_tablespaces; --查询数据文件信息 --autoextensible数据库已满后是否自动扩展 selecttablespace_name,bytes,autoextensible,file_namefromdba_data_files; /******************************************************************/ --创建表空间 --???一般信息 --???????DATAFILE:数据文件目录 --???????????存储 --???????????????AUTOEXTEND:数据文件满后自动扩展 --???????????????????ONNEXT:增量 --???????????????????MAXSIZEUNLIMITED:最大容量无限制 --???????SIZE:文件大小 -

您可能关注的文档

文档评论(0)

1亿VIP精品文档

相关文档